DIY vs Professional
In Charlottesville, Virginia, off-the-shelf termites products can provide short-term relief, but lasting control usually requires targeted treatment of hidden infestation sources.Over-the-counter sprays and traps typically focus on visible pests, leaving the hidden ones alone.Exterminators employ EPA-registered formulations at levels not sold to the general public, along with strategies that target every phase of pest development.Although a DIY pest control attempt may be $20 to $100 at the start, the expense of a failure, with property damage and a more severe infestation, usually surpasses the cost of professional extermination.For reliable results, professional termite control is the smarter investment.

Prevention Tips
- โRepair damaged window screens and weather stripping.
- โStore firewood away from the house and elevate it off the ground.
- โSchedule annual professional inspections to catch problems early.
- โInspect secondhand furniture, luggage, and packages before bringing them inside.
- โPrune plants away from the building and keep mulch at least 6 inches from the foundation.
- โTake away clutter and organic debris from the surrounding area that could provide pest harborage.
